The City of Vinnytsia has announced that they will be holding a fundraising concert to help pay for Darina Krasnovetska to take part in Junior Eurovision 2018.

On November 14 the City of Vinnytsia will hold a fundraising concert to help raise the funds required to pay for Darina Krasnovetska to participate in Junior Eurovision 2018. The city council has already confirmed that they will help pay towards the 100,000 UAH required for Darina to take to the stage in Minsk, Belarus.

Tickets for the concert which will include Darina cost 100 UAH, with all of the funds going towards the fund. The venue for the concert has also been donated free of charge to help ensure that Darina receives the necessary funds.

The Vinnytsia  City Council is one of a number of organisations and companies to pledge funds to help fund Ukraine’s participation in Junior Eurovision 2018.

Who is Darina Krasnovetska?

Eleven-year-old Darina Krasnovetska was born on 12th May 2007 in Vinnytsia, Ukraine. The young singer has been taking singing classes for over five years, and her other hobbies include travelling, contemporary dancing, painting, and playing the piano. Her greatest achievements in her career include participating in The Voice Kids in Ukraine, and winning the Black Sea Games two times.

In September this year, Darina and nine other artists took part in the Ukrainian Junior Eurovision selection show. In the end, Darina took the crown after the jury panel of music experts decided she would be the best candidate. She will compete this November with the song “Say Love”.

Ukraine debuted in the Junior Eurovision Song Contest in 2006 and has competed in the contest ever since. To date Ukraine has only won the competition once. In 2012 Anastasiya Petryk won in Amsterdam with the song “Nebo”, she scored 138 points including eight sets of 12 points. Ukraine has hosted the contest twice, the first time being in 2009 and the second being in 2013 following their victory in Amsterdam.
